New Peoples Bankshares  (OTCPK:NWPP) Median PS Value Explanation

This valuation method assumes that the stock valuation will revert to its historical (10-Year) mean in terms of PS Ratio. The reason we use PS Ratio instead of PE Ratio or PB Ratio is because PS Ratio is independent of profit margin, and can be applied to a broader range of situations.

It also assumes that over time the profit margin is constant. If a company increases its profit margin to a sustainable level, this value might under-estimate its value. If it has permanent declined profit margins, this may over-estimate the company's value.

New Peoples Bankshares Business Description

Address 67 Commerce Drive, Honaker, VA, USA, 24260
New Peoples Bankshares Inc is a bank holding company for New Peoples Bank. The Bank offers a range of banking & related financial services focused on serving individuals, small to medium-sized businesses, and the professional community. Its main banking services include personal banking, business banking, and financial services. These services include commercial and consumer loans, along with traditional deposit products such as checking and savings accounts. Its banking products comprise checking, savings, deposit accounts, commercial loans, consumer loans, and real estate loans. The Company's revenue is derived from the business of banking.
